Aller au contenu

Migrer son site sans coupure : méthode et checklist

    Changer d’hébergeur, déplacer un site vers une nouvelle infrastructure ou refondre son environnement technique peut vite devenir risqué si la transition est mal préparée. Une migration site web réussie ne se résume pas à copier des fichiers : elle implique la coordination de l’hébergement, de la base de données, des DNS, de la sécurité, des tests et de la mise en ligne.

    Bonne nouvelle : il est possible d’effectuer un transfert hébergement presque invisible pour les visiteurs. Avec une méthode rigoureuse, un calendrier maîtrisé et une vraie checklist migration, vous pouvez basculer votre site sans coupure, sans perte de données et sans impact SEO majeur.

    Pourquoi une migration de site web peut provoquer des coupures

    Une migration peut concerner plusieurs réalités : changement d’hébergeur, transfert vers un serveur plus puissant, passage d’un environnement mutualisé à un VPS, déploiement sur une nouvelle stack technique ou encore déplacement d’un site vers une architecture cloud. Dans tous les cas, le risque principal est le même : créer un décalage entre l’ancien environnement et le nouveau.

    Les coupures surviennent généralement pour cinq raisons :

    • Propagation DNS mal anticipée : le nom de domaine pointe vers l’ancien serveur pour certains visiteurs et vers le nouveau pour d’autres.
    • Base de données non synchronisée : des commandes, formulaires ou contenus sont enregistrés sur l’ancien site après la copie initiale.
    • Configuration serveur incomplète : PHP, réécritures d’URL, cache, cron ou permissions diffèrent entre les deux hébergements.
    • Certificat SSL absent ou invalide après le basculement.
    • Tests insuffisants avant la mise en production.

    Une migration site web sans interruption repose donc sur un principe simple : préparer le nouvel environnement à l’identique, le tester en profondeur, puis basculer le trafic au bon moment. Le vrai enjeu n’est pas seulement le transfert des données, mais l’orchestration du changement.

    Définir la bonne stratégie de migration sans coupure

    Pour migrer sans coupure, il faut éviter la logique du “on copie et on verra ensuite”. La meilleure approche consiste à travailler en parallèle sur deux environnements :

    • l’environnement source, encore en production ;
    • l’environnement cible, entièrement préparé avant la bascule.

    Cette méthode permet de réduire drastiquement le temps d’indisponibilité, voire de le rendre imperceptible. Concrètement, vous préparez le nouveau serveur, vous importez le site, vous le testez sur une URL de préproduction, puis vous effectuez la bascule DNS à un moment où le trafic est faible.

    Avant toute opération, définissez :

    • le périmètre exact de la migration ;
    • la date et l’heure du basculement ;
    • les responsables techniques ;
    • le plan de retour arrière ;
    • les indicateurs à surveiller après la mise en ligne.

    Si vous gérez aussi le domaine, prenez le temps de revoir la gestion du nom de domaine et des DNS. C’est souvent à ce niveau que les erreurs les plus coûteuses se produisent : mauvais enregistrement A, TTL trop long, zone DNS incomplète ou oubli d’un sous-domaine critique.

    Préparer la migration : audit complet avant le transfert

    Une migration réussie commence toujours par un audit. Vous devez savoir exactement ce que vous déplacez, comment cela fonctionne et quelles dépendances risquent de casser lors du transfert hébergement.

    Inventorier les composants du site

    • fichiers du site ;
    • base ou bases de données ;
    • version de PHP, MySQL, Node.js ou autre runtime ;
    • extensions, thèmes, modules et bibliothèques ;
    • tâches planifiées ;
    • emails transactionnels ;
    • sous-domaines ;
    • certificats SSL ;
    • règles de redirection ;
    • CDN, cache, WAF ou firewall applicatif.

    Analyser les points sensibles

    Certains sites demandent une vigilance particulière :

    • e-commerce : commandes, paiements, gestion du stock ;
    • site média : fort trafic et cache complexe ;
    • site multilingue : redirections et structure d’URL ;
    • application métier : dépendances serveur spécifiques ;
    • WordPress avec plugins nombreux : conflits possibles entre environnements.

    Avant de toucher à quoi que ce soit, il est indispensable de sauvegarder le site avant la migration. La sauvegarde doit être complète, vérifiée et stockée sur un emplacement externe. Une sauvegarde inutilisable le jour d’un incident n’est pas une sauvegarde, c’est une fausse sécurité.

    Réduire le TTL DNS

    Quelques heures, voire 24 à 48 heures avant la bascule, diminuez le TTL des enregistrements DNS concernés. Cela accélère la propagation lors du changement d’IP et limite le temps pendant lequel certains utilisateurs voient encore l’ancien serveur.

    Cette étape est décisive pour une migration sans coupure. Trop d’entreprises la négligent et se retrouvent avec une transition confuse pendant plusieurs heures.

    Configurer le nouvel hébergement avant la bascule

    Le nouveau serveur ne doit pas être “à moitié prêt” au moment de la migration. Il doit être entièrement opérationnel avant même que le trafic réel n’y arrive. C’est la règle numéro un pour éviter toute coupure de service, et vous pouvez approfondir le sujet ici : éviter toute coupure de service.

    Reproduire l’environnement technique

    Vérifiez systématiquement :

    • la version de PHP et ses modules ;
    • la configuration du serveur web (Apache, Nginx, LiteSpeed) ;
    • les limites mémoire et d’exécution ;
    • les accès SSH, SFTP et base de données ;
    • les permissions fichiers/dossiers ;
    • la compression, le cache et les headers ;
    • les règles de sécurité.

    L’objectif n’est pas forcément d’avoir une copie parfaite de l’ancien serveur, mais un environnement compatible, stable et documenté.

    Importer le site et la base de données

    Le transfert hébergement comprend en général :

    • la copie des fichiers ;
    • l’export puis l’import de la base de données ;
    • l’ajustement des fichiers de configuration ;
    • la mise à jour des chemins, identifiants et variables d’environnement.

    Pour les sites dynamiques, prévoyez une méthode de synchronisation finale juste avant la bascule. Cela évite de perdre des données créées entre la première copie et la mise en production.

    Installer et préparer le SSL

    Le HTTPS doit être prêt avant le changement DNS. Une fois la bascule effectuée, prenez le temps de vérifier le certificat SSL après le transfert. Contrôlez la validité du certificat, la chaîne de confiance, le renouvellement automatique et l’absence de contenu mixte.

    Tester le site en préproduction comme s’il était déjà en ligne

    L’une des erreurs les plus fréquentes est de tester “vite fait” la page d’accueil et deux ou trois URLs. Ce n’est pas suffisant. Une migration réussie exige une vraie recette fonctionnelle et technique.

    Tester les pages et fonctionnalités clés

    • page d’accueil ;
    • pages stratégiques SEO ;
    • formulaires de contact ;
    • connexion utilisateur ;
    • processus de commande ;
    • moteur de recherche interne ;
    • zone d’administration ;
    • emails automatiques ;
    • uploads de fichiers ou images ;
    • redirections 301 et pages 404.

    Contrôler les performances

    Une migration site web ne doit pas seulement préserver la disponibilité, elle peut aussi améliorer les temps de chargement. Testez :

    • le TTFB ;
    • le poids des pages ;
    • la mise en cache ;
    • la compression GZIP ou Brotli ;
    • les images et scripts ;
    • le comportement sous charge si possible.

    Valider le SEO technique

    Le SEO peut être fragilisé pendant une migration si certains éléments changent sans contrôle :

    • balises title et meta robots ;
    • structure des URLs ;
    • sitemap XML ;
    • fichier robots.txt ;
    • canonical ;
    • codes HTTP ;
    • liens internes ;
    • redirections.

    Un site accessible mais mal indexable reste une migration ratée. La stabilité fonctionnelle et la continuité SEO doivent être traitées ensemble.

    Effectuer la mise en ligne sans interruption visible

    Quand tout est prêt, la mise en ligne doit suivre une séquence précise. C’est ici que votre checklist migration prend tout son sens.

    1. Choisir le bon créneau

    Programmez la bascule sur une période de faible trafic. Évitez les heures de pointe, les lancements marketing, les campagnes emailing ou les périodes commerciales sensibles.

    2. Geler temporairement les contenus sensibles

    Selon le type de site, vous pouvez activer un gel partiel : suspension des publications, gel du back-office éditorial, désactivation temporaire des transactions à risque ou passage en maintenance pour l’administration uniquement. Le but est d’empêcher des écarts entre l’ancien et le nouveau serveur au moment critique.

    3. Lancer la synchronisation finale

    Juste avant la bascule, réalisez la dernière copie des données modifiées : base de données, fichiers médias récents, commandes, leads ou comptes créés depuis la première importation.

    4. Modifier les DNS

    Changez les enregistrements nécessaires pour faire pointer le domaine vers le nouveau serveur. Grâce au TTL réduit en amont, la propagation sera plus rapide. Pendant cette phase, surveillez attentivement les accès, les erreurs serveur et les certificats.

    5. Maintenir l’ancien serveur pendant la transition

    Ne résiliez jamais l’ancien hébergement immédiatement. Conservez-le actif le temps que la propagation soit complète et que tous les contrôles soient validés. C’est une sécurité essentielle pour toute migration sans coupure.

    Pour cadrer ce moment clé, il est aussi utile de préparer la mise en ligne dans de bonnes conditions, en particulier si plusieurs intervenants participent au déploiement.

    Checklist migration : les points à valider avant, pendant et après

    Voici une checklist migration opérationnelle à utiliser pour sécuriser votre projet.

    Avant la migration

    • définir le périmètre exact du projet ;
    • auditer les composants techniques du site ;
    • réaliser une sauvegarde complète et testée ;
    • réduire le TTL DNS ;
    • préparer le nouvel hébergement ;
    • installer les dépendances serveur nécessaires ;
    • copier les fichiers et importer la base ;
    • configurer les accès, permissions et variables ;
    • installer le certificat SSL ;
    • tester le site en préproduction ;
    • préparer un plan de rollback.

    Pendant la migration

    • choisir un créneau à faible trafic ;
    • geler les écritures sensibles si nécessaire ;
    • effectuer la synchronisation finale ;
    • mettre à jour les DNS ;
    • surveiller les logs serveur ;
    • contrôler les réponses HTTP et le HTTPS ;
    • vérifier les parcours critiques en direct.

    Après la migration

    • contrôler l’affichage sur desktop et mobile ;
    • tester formulaires, commandes et connexions ;
    • vérifier les redirections ;
    • confirmer la bonne génération des emails ;
    • analyser la vitesse de chargement ;
    • surveiller l’indexation et les erreurs dans la Search Console ;
    • maintenir l’ancien serveur quelques jours ;
    • documenter les changements effectués.

    Les erreurs à éviter lors d’un transfert d’hébergement

    Même avec un bon plan, certaines erreurs reviennent souvent :

    • changer trop de choses à la fois : hébergeur, design, CMS, structure d’URL et SEO dans un même projet augmentent fortement le risque ;
    • oublier les emails : un site migré mais des emails hors service peuvent perturber l’activité ;
    • ne pas tester les formulaires : c’est l’un des bugs les plus courants après la mise en ligne ;
    • supprimer trop vite l’ancien serveur : cela empêche tout retour arrière rapide ;
    • négliger les redirections : elles sont critiques si la structure d’URL évolue ;
    • laisser un noindex actif sur le nouveau site ;
    • ignorer les logs : ils révèlent souvent des erreurs invisibles au premier regard.

    Une autre erreur fréquente est de considérer la migration comme une tâche purement technique. En réalité, elle touche aussi le marketing, le SEO, le support client, les ventes et parfois la conformité. Plus votre site est stratégique, plus la coordination doit être rigoureuse.

    Après la migration : surveillance, SEO et stabilisation

    La migration ne s’arrête pas au changement DNS. Les 24 à 72 heures suivantes sont décisives. C’est durant cette fenêtre que vous devez vérifier si tout fonctionne réellement en conditions réelles.

    Surveiller les indicateurs clés

    • disponibilité du site ;
    • temps de réponse ;
    • erreurs 4xx et 5xx ;
    • taux de conversion ;
    • réception des formulaires ;
    • volumétrie de trafic ;
    • pages indexées ;
    • comportement des bots.

    Confirmer la continuité SEO

    Surveillez la Search Console, les journaux serveur et vos outils d’analyse. Une légère fluctuation est normale, mais une chute brutale du trafic organique, des pages désindexées ou des erreurs massives de crawl doivent être traitées immédiatement.

    Si la structure des URLs n’a pas changé et que la migration a été correctement exécutée, l’impact SEO doit rester limité. En revanche, si vous combinez migration site web et refonte profonde, prévoyez un suivi renforcé pendant plusieurs semaines.

    Documenter pour les prochaines évolutions

    Conservez un journal précis de la migration : date, heure, actions menées, DNS modifiés, tests réalisés, incidents rencontrés et solutions appliquées. Cette documentation vous fera gagner un temps précieux lors d’une future montée en charge, d’un changement d’infrastructure ou d’une nouvelle mise à jour majeure.

    En résumé, réussir une migration sans coupure demande de la méthode, pas de l’improvisation. Si vous préparez l’environnement cible, sécurisez les données, maîtrisez les DNS, testez chaque fonctionnalité et surveillez la phase post-bascule, votre transfert hébergement peut se faire en douceur, avec un risque minimal pour vos utilisateurs et votre visibilité.

    Vous préparez une mise en ligne sensible ou une migration site web stratégique ? Appuyez-vous sur cette méthode et transformez votre prochaine bascule en opération maîtrisée. Mieux vaut investir dans une vraie checklist migration aujourd’hui que réparer une coupure demain.

    Rate this post